WebMar 3, 2024 · The 5 stages of infection explained 1. Incubation. The incubation stage includes the time from exposure to an infectious agent until the onset of symptoms. 2. Prodromal. The prodromal stage refers to the … WebStage one: incubation period The time between infection and the development of the earliest symptoms Stage two: prodromal phase Early symptoms develop Stage three: acute phase Peak of disease Stage four: period of decline Replication of the infectious agent is brought under control; symptoms start to resolve Stage five: convalescent phase
